Curb weight of Nissan Almera G15: what is it and why is it important

Curb weight (or “unloaded weight”) is the weight of the vehicle in its basic configuration, including all operating fluids (oil, antifreeze, fuel for 90% of the tank volume), but without driver, passengers and cargo. For Nissan Almera G15 this parameter varies depending on the type of transmission and configuration:

  • 🔧 Manual transmission (1.6 l, 102 hp): 1,120–1,150 kg
  • 🔄 Automatic transmission (1.6 l, 102 hp): 1,160–1,190 kg
  • Versions with air conditioning: +15–20 kg to base weight

Why is this important? Curb weight - basis for calculation gross permissible weight (more about her below). For example, if you are planning to install gas equipment (+20-30 kg), it is important to ensure that the total weight does not exceed the limits. This parameter is also taken into account when towing: the trailer should not weigh more than 0.7 × curb weight (for Almera G15 this is ~800 kg).

Where can you find the exact weight of your car? Look for the sign on driver's door pillar or in PTS (field "Weight without load"). If data is not available, use the average values ​​from the table below.

Gross permissible weight: how much can be loaded

Gross Permissible Weight (GVW) - this is the maximum weight of the car with cargo, passengers and driver, which is allowed by the manufacturer. For Nissan Almera G15 this parameter is fixed:

  • 🚗 All modifications: 1,630 kg
  • 👥 Calculation for passengers: 5 people (75 kg each) = 375 kg
  • 📦 Cargo balance: ~100–150 kg (including fuel and equipment)

This means that if the curb weight of your car is 1,150 kg, then maximum weight of cargo + passengers should not exceed 1,630 – 1,150 = 480 kg. However, there is a nuance here: axle load distribution. Overloading even one axle by 10–15% can lead to:

  • ⚠️ Deterioration of controllability (especially at high speed)
  • ⚠️ Uneven tire wear
  • ⚠️ Risk of damage to the suspension when falling into a hole

How to avoid problems? Use weight control at gas stations or buy portable wheel scales (cost from 2,000 ₽). An alternative is to calculate using the formula:

Масса на ось = (Снаряжённая масса × % распределения) + (Масса груза × % его расположения)

For Almera G15 curb weight distribution: front axle - 60%, rear - 40%.

Axle weight: norms and consequences of overload

The manufacturer sets strict load limits for each axle Nissan Almera G15. Exceeding these standards leads not only to fines (according to Art. 12.21 Code of Administrative Offenses of the Russian Federation), but also to technical problems:

Parameter Front axle Rear axle
Max. permissible load 850 kg 820 kg
Curb load 660–690 kg 460–490 kg
Recommended stock up to 150 kg up to 100 kg

Calculation example: if you are carrying 4 passengers (300 kg) and 100 kg of cargo in the trunk, the rear axle will have to 460 kg (curb) + 400 kg (cargo + passengers) = 860 kg - what exceeds the limit by 40 kg. Solution: redistribute some of the cargo into the cabin or reduce the load.

Consequences of systematic overload:

  • 🔧 Suspension: sagging springs, shock absorber leaks, wear of stabilizer bushings
  • 🛞 Tires: uneven tread wear (especially at the edges), risk of explosion when heated
  • 🚗 Brakes: increase in braking distance by 20–30% due to overheating of the pads

Effect of mass on dynamics and fuel consumption

Every extra kilogram of cargo affects acceleration, braking and appetite Nissan Almera G15. For example, with a load of 400 kg (passengers + luggage):

  • 🚀 Acceleration to 100 km/h worsens by 1.2–1.5 sec (from 11.5 to 12.7–13.0 sec)
  • Fuel consumption grows by 0.8–1.2 l/100 km (in the city up to 9.5 l instead of 8.3 l)
  • 🛑 Braking distance from 80 km/h increases by 3–4 meters

The influence of mass on automatic transmission: the box begins to “stupid” when switching, and the torque converter overheats. If you frequently drive with a load, keep an eye on ATF temperature (optimally 80–90°C). Exceeding 110°C leads to oil degradation and friction wear.

Modifications and tuning: how they affect weight

Installing additional equipment changes the weight characteristics Almera G15. Let's look at popular improvements and their impact:

Modification Weight gain Consequences
HBO (4th generation) +25–35 kg Shifting the center of gravity back, increasing the load on the rear axle
Crankcase protection (steel, 4 mm) +8–12 kg Deterioration in clearance by 10–15 mm
Alloy wheels (R16 instead of R15) +2–4 kg per wheel Increased load on wheel bearings
Soundproofing (full set) +40–60 kg Increase in fuel consumption by 0.3–0.5 l/100 km

⚠️ Attention: if the total weight gain exceeds 50 kg, it is necessary to adjust the tire pressure (increase by 0.2 bar) and check the headlight settings (the angle of inclination may change).

Frequent mistakes made by owners when loading Almera G15

Analysis of forums (for example, Drive2 or Almera-Club.ru) shows that owners often make the same mistakes:

  1. Ignoring load distribution. For example, transporting 200 kg of building materials in the trunk without securing it leads to a shift in the center of gravity and the risk of skidding when cornering.
  2. Not taking into account trailer weight. Even a light trailer (500 kg) increases the load on the coupling device, which is Almera G15 designed for a maximum of 600 kg.
  3. Roof overload. Many people install boxes weighing 30–40 kg, not taking into account that maximum roof load — 50 kg (including the weight of the trunk).

⚠️ Attention: If you carry skis or bicycles on the roof, use aerodynamic mounts (For example, Thule). Improper fixation increases fuel consumption by 0.7–1.0 l/100 km due to air resistance.
